This program includes the following components: a combination of online and live theory lecture; multiple laboratory sessions for students to practice topics learned in theory; 60 hours of required EMS clinicals; 24 hours of required hospital clinicals; 24 hours of required hospital or EMS clinicals; 20 required patient contacts.

Requires EMT certification and license.

The student must be able to read and write in accordance with at least an 8th grade level. Must be able to read, write and speak English at a conversational level, including the ability to learn medical terminology.

The School of EMS operates on a rolling admissions schedule. As such, AEMT courses are offered throughout the year to accommodate the needs of community partners. Students must apply at least one month before the start date of their chosen AEMT course.
